For traders facing challenges and uncertainties, it’s critical to remain resilient and focused on long-term goals. A common theme in trading is the narrative of perseverance, illustrated in Russell Conwell’s parable "Acres of Diamonds." The story revolves around a man who sells his farm in pursuit of wealth, only to find that the riches he sought were right beneath his feet. This reflects the experience of many traders who nearly quit just before experiencing a breakthrough.
Successful trading often emphasizes the importance of process over profits. Many accomplished traders, despite initial losses, swear by the necessity of following a structured trading plan. Their focus shifts from solely winning to mastering their strategy and accepting losses as part of the learning curve.
Traders are encouraged to understand their preferred setups without succumbing to the pressure of capturing every market opportunity. This involves recognizing that not every method will suit every trader, and being selective can lead to better outcomes. Furthermore, detaching emotionally from trades allows for clearer judgment, particularly in accepting losses as opportunities to learn.
Traders should further emphasize a holistic view of the market, acknowledging external factors that can influence stock performance. Staying informed about broader market trends and news is essential for making sound trading decisions.
In summary, persistence, emotional regulation, and market awareness are crucial for improving trading strategies and achieving long-term success.
